CARNEY, Judge.

This is the second time this case has been before this court. Upon the first trial the Chancellor dismissed the complainant's original bill on the grounds that he was not a bona fide citizen and resident of Shelby County, Tennessee, and for the further reason that he had not proven sufficient grounds for a divorce.
